More information on Holiday Inn Express Savannah-historic District
Stay in the heart of the historic district and soak up the splendor that is Savannah. Next time your travels take you to Savannah, choose the brand new Holiday Inn Express Historic District. This contemporary Southern style property is located right on Bay St. and is surrounded by dozens of boutiques, restaurants, River Street and Savannah®s famed squares. It features a graceful lobby, full service fireside lobby bar, a rooftop pool and gazebo and guest rooms equipped with flat screen TVs. Rates include deluxe continental breakfast and high speed internet access. This hotel is committed to providing accessible facilities under the American Disabilities Act. If your accessibility needs are not met, please contact the Hotel Manager on Duty.
